Jack, As a rule of thumb, prior to the end of WW1 both military & commerical luger grips would have had the last 2 digit stamped inside each grip panel, Contract gun were done to the buyers specifications (eg M1908 Bulgarians -- no serial, Dutch contract == many will have the full 4 digits stamps from top to bottom). After WW1, most commercial and some military grips will be unnumbered, until Mauser took over in 1930 when most military grips were again numbered, per existing regulations. TH
